'Montagne Noire'

The old mountain called the « Massif Central » was raised again when the nees an the Alps wre created.

It bears various names depending on the area, and is called « Montagne Noire » on its South border.

It is made by rolling hills, getting lower and lower towards the plain where Carcassonne was built, as a latch between Toulouse and the Mediteranean.

These hills offer poor soil and hot weather, and are covered mainly with evergreen oaks and « garrigue ». There were built in medieval times the Cathare castles of Lastours.

Very dry, well drained, it is a mixture of clay with a high percentage of schists.

Not really suited for any culture but vines which thrive on this ground.

Varietal is :

Merlot 100%

Harvest is entirely manual and the grapes are totally destemmed.

Wine making is traditional. Maceration lasts around 12 days with a temperature control at 28°C.

Serve between 14 and 16°C.

Red fruit bouquet, taste of ripe black cherry, with a soft tannin structure.

This wine will suit perfectly a pique nique or a barbecue party with friends.
